rep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Relicensing TinyCC
2013-05-05
Thomas Preud'homme
R
e
licensing TinyCC
commit
|
commitdiff
|
tree
2013-04-08
Thomas P
r
e
u
d'homme
Fix
b
u
i
l
di
n
g
i
nstru
c
tion wrt ma
k
e
/
gmake
commit
|
commitdiff
|
tree
2013-03-19
Thomas Preud'homme
Fi
x
syn
c
h
r
onizat
i
on betwe
e
n data and instr caches
commit
|
commitdiff
|
tree
2013-03-18
Tho
m
as P
r
eud'ho
m
me
Flush cache
s
before
-runn
i
ng program
commit
|
commitdiff
|
tree
2013-03-14
Thomas Preu
d
'hom
m
e
Fix configure
script on F
r
eeBSD
commit
|
commitdiff
|
tree
2013-03-11
Thomas Preud'homme
U
p
d
ate
.
gitig
n
ore wit
h
regards to test changes
commit
|
commitdiff
|
tree
2013-02-18
Thoma
s
Preud'homme
Fix
GNU Hurd in
t
erpreter pa
t
h
commit
|
commitdiff
|
tree
2013-02-18
Tho
m
as Preud'h
o
mme
Add support
f
or Kfre
e
B
SD
64bits
commit
|
commitdiff
|
tree
2013-02-17
T
homas Preu
d
'
homme
Define __STDC_HOSTED__
t
o
a
s
ane value
commit
|
commitdiff
|
tree
2013-02-17
T
h
om
a
s Pr
e
ud
'
homme
Define
__STD
C
_HOSTED__
commit
|
commitdiff
|
tree
2013-02-15
Thoma
s
Preud'
h
omme
Release T
i
nyCC 0
.
9
.
26
commit
|
commitdiff
|
tree
2013-02-14
Thomas
Preud'homme
Revert "
D
o
n't
s
ear
c
h li
b
gcc
_
s
.
so
.
1 on /lib64"
commit
|
commitdiff
|
tree
2013-02-14
Thoma
s
Preud'homme
Don't s
e
arch libgcc_s
.
s
o
.
1 on /lib64
commit
|
commitdiff
|
tree
2013-02-14
Thomas Preu
d
'ho
m
me
Add missing
h
eadin
g
slash to dete
c
t /lib64 s
y
stems
commit
|
commitdiff
|
tree
2013-02-14
Thomas Preu
d
'homme
Ad
d
arm ABI detection in
c
onftest
.
c
commit
|
commitdiff
|
tree
2013-02-14
Thomas Preud'homme
An
o
t
her attemp
t
to "detect" m
u
ltiarch
commit
|
commitdiff
|
tree
2013-02-13
Thoma
s
Pr
e
ud'homme
Create config-print pr
o
gram t
o
test $cc
commit
|
commitdiff
|
tree
2013-02-13
Thoma
s
Pr
e
ud'
h
omme
Vario
u
s
f
i
x
es for f
9
a
c2013
commit
|
commitdiff
|
tree
2013-02-13
Tho
m
as Pr
e
ud'ho
m
me
D
e
t
e
ct m
u
lti
a
rch triplet
a
n
d
l
ddir from ldd
o
ut
p
ut
commit
|
commitdiff
|
tree
2013-02-13
Th
o
mas Pre
u
d'homme
Fix previous commit
commit
|
commitdiff
|
tree
2013-02-13
T
h
omas Preu
d
'hom
m
e
I
m
p
r
o
ve mu
l
tiarch
d
etection
commit
|
commitdiff
|
tree
2013-02-08
Thomas
Preud'homme
Fix fn_dir
n
ame in
c
onfigure scrip
t
commit
|
commitdiff
|
tree
2013-02-05
Tho
m
as Pr
e
ud'homme
Align
o
n
4
n
bytes
w
hen copying fct
a
rgs on stack
commit
|
commitdiff
|
tree
2013-02-04
Tho
m
a
s
Preud'ho
m
m
e
S
l
ightly i
m
proved
support for !gcc compilers
commit
|
commitdiff
|
tree
2013-02-04
Thom
a
s Preud'homm
e
a
rm-gen
.
c: fix var in
i
tializatio
n
in gfunc_call
commit
|
commitdiff
|
tree
2013-01-31
T
h
omas
P
reud'homm
e
R
e
v
ert "Add p
r
edict
a
bilit
y
in CType in
i
tializ
a
tion
.
"
commit
|
commitdiff
|
tree
2013-01-31
Thomas Preud'homm
e
Rev
e
rt "Don't call
e
lf_
h
ash o
n
NULL value"
commit
|
commitdiff
|
tree
2013-01-31
Tho
m
as Preud'homm
e
Revert
"Check whether structure fields ha
v
e a type"
commit
|
commitdiff
|
tree
2013-01-31
Thomas Preud'homme
Check whether structure f
i
e
lds have a type
commit
|
commitdiff
|
tree
2013-01-31
Domingo Alvarez
.
.
.
Don't call elf_hash on
NULL value
Signed-off-by: Thomas Preud'homme <
robotux@celest.fr
>
commit
|
commitdiff
|
tree
2013-01-31
Domin
g
o
A
lvarez
.
.
.
Add
p
r
e
d
i
ctability in CTyp
e
initializati
o
n
.
Signed-off-by: Thomas Preud'homme <
robotux@celest.fr
>
commit
|
commitdiff
|
tree
2013-01-30
Tho
m
as Preud'homme
Fix cross-co
m
pilation ou
t
-of-
t
ree build
commit
|
commitdiff
|
tree
2013-01-30
Thom
a
s P
r
eud'h
o
mme
A
d
d
my co
p
yright fo
r
changes in arm-gen
.
c
commit
|
commitdiff
|
tree
2013-01-30
Thomas Preud'hom
m
e
Chan
g
elog upd
a
te
commit
|
commitdiff
|
tree
2013-01-30
Thomas Preud'
h
omme
Update Change
l
og
commit
|
commitdiff
|
tree
2013-01-29
Thomas Preud'homme
F
avo
r
arm hardflo
a
t over arm s
o
ft
f
loat
.
commit
|
commitdiff
|
tree
2013-01-28
Thomas Preud'homme
Fix
overflow detection in AR
M
r
e
locati
o
n
commit
|
commitdiff
|
tree
2013-01-27
T
h
o
mas Preud'h
o
mme
Fix stack
a
lig
n
ment
o
n 8 bytes
a
t
f
u
nction call
commit
|
commitdiff
|
tree
2013-01-26
Thomas Preud'homme
D
on't
d
o
builtin_frame_addr
e
ss t
e
st
w
ith ARM gcc
commit
|
commitdiff
|
tree
2013-01-26
Thomas Preud'homme
Organize frames in a real linked lis
t
on ARM
commit
|
commitdiff
|
tree
2013-01-25
Thom
a
s
Preud
'
homme
Use gcc to generate tcc
t
est
.
gcc
commit
|
commitdiff
|
tree
2013-01-25
Thomas Preud'homme
Link ST
T
_
G
NU_IFUN
C
int
o
STT
_
FUNC in execu
t
able
.
commit
|
commitdiff
|
tree
2013-01-24
T
homas Preud'homm
e
Fix
[
f]getc retur
n
v
alue us
a
ge in
40_st
d
i
o
test
commit
|
commitdiff
|
tree
2013-01-14
Thomas Preud'hom
m
e
Fix out-of-tree b
u
i
l
d
with rel
a
ti
v
e path
t
o root
commit
|
commitdiff
|
tree
2013-01-14
Thoma
s
Pre
u
d
'homme
Instal
l
l
ibtcc
.
h when invoking make
i
nstall
commit
|
commitdiff
|
tree
2013-01-14
Tho
m
as
P
r
eud'homme
R
e
v
e
rt "Added what I call virtu
a
l io
t
o tinycc this
.
.
.
commit
|
commitdiff
|
tree
2013-01-14
Tho
m
as Preu
d
'homme
Revert "pe: f
i
x
tcc no
t
linki
n
g to
u
ser32 and
g
di
3
2"
commit
|
commitdiff
|
tree
2013-01-13
T
h
o
m
as
P
re
u
d'homme
S
top setting -Wno-un
u
s
e
d-res
u
lt switch i
n
Makefile
commit
|
commitdiff
|
tree
2013-01-13
T
h
om
a
s Pr
e
u
d
'homme
Fix C
9
9is
m
in
v
s
wap()
commit
|
commitdiff
|
tree
2013-01-06
Thomas Preud'ho
m
me
Sto
p
retur
n
i
n
g 0 in c
m
p
_comparison_tes
t
commit
|
commitdiff
|
tree
2013-01-06
Th
o
mas Pr
e
ud'ho
m
me
Honor
CC when testing for -Wno-
u
nused-result
commit
|
commitdiff
|
tree
2012-12-04
T
h
omas Preud'
h
omme
Detect ARM CPU ver
s
i
o
n in conf
i
g
u
re
commit
|
commitdiff
|
tree
2012-11-28
Thom
a
s Preud'homme
ar
m
-gen
.
c: Invalid o
p
erator test
a
lways false
commit
|
commitdiff
|
tree
2012-11-28
Thomas
P
reud'homme
Fix OABI c
a
lling conv
e
ntion
commit
|
commitdiff
|
tree
2012-11-21
T
h
o
mas
Pre
u
d'h
o
mme
On
l
y refe
r
ence
vfpr when
available
commit
|
commitdiff
|
tree
2012-11-20
Thoma
s
Pre
u
d
'homme
Define
T
C
C
_ARM_EABI if using
hardfloat ABI
commit
|
commitdiff
|
tree
2012-11-17
Thomas Preud'ho
m
me
Ge
n
e
rate
P
L
T thumb stub
only when necessary
commit
|
commitdiff
|
tree
2012-11-12
T
homas
Preu
d
'homme
Revert "Gen
e
rate PLT thumb st
u
b only whe
n
nec
e
ssa
r
y"
commit
|
commitdiff
|
tree
2012-11-11
T
homas
Preud'h
o
m
m
e
Add armv6
l
to ARM
s
upport
e
d process
o
r
s
commit
|
commitdiff
|
tree
2012-11-09
Thomas
Preud'homme
Call to ven
e
ers i
n
ARM mode
commit
|
commitdiff
|
tree
2012-11-07
Tho
m
as
Preud'homme
Allow s
o
urc
e
fo
r
tification
commit
|
commitdiff
|
tree
2012-11-07
Thomas
P
reud'homm
e
Generate PLT
t
h
umb stub only w
h
en ne
c
ess
a
ry
commit
|
commitdiff
|
tree
2012-11-07
Th
o
mas Preud'ho
m
me
Support R
_
ARM_
T
HM_JU
M
P24 relocatio
n
to
p
lt
commit
|
commitdiff
|
tree
2012-11-07
T
h
o
m
as Preud'h
o
mme
Cr
e
ate a cl
e
an target
f
o
r
t
ests2/Makefile
commit
|
commitdiff
|
tree
2012-11-06
Thomas Preud'h
o
mme
H
o
nour
*
FLAGS everywhere
commit
|
commitdiff
|
tree
2012-10-28
Thomas
P
reud'h
o
mme
Enable
a
rm hardfloat c
a
lling convention
commit
|
commitdiff
|
tree
2012-10-28
Thomas Preud'homme
Ad
d
support for R_
A
RM_THM_{JUMP24,CALL} re
l
ocs
commit
|
commitdiff
|
tree
2012-10-25
Thomas
P
r
e
u
d'homme
Fix commit 85f
6
fad
3
a6acbfa07a3dc45b6
7
3
9
65fc2
6
8
9
0d8e
commit
|
commitdiff
|
tree
2012-10-25
Thoma
s
Pre
u
d'homme
Err
o
r out
in
case of variable n
a
m
e
c
l
ash
commit
|
commitdiff
|
tree
2012-10-25
Thomas Preud'homme
F
o
rbid VLA as static v
a
ria
b
les
commit
|
commitdiff
|
tree
2012-10-15
Thoma
s
P
reud'homme
Only u
s
e
b
l
x if available
commit
|
commitdiff
|
tree
2012-10-09
Thomas Preud'h
o
m
m
e
F
i
x R_ARM_CA
L
L
w
hen
t
arget fonction is
T
humb
commit
|
commitdiff
|
tree
2012-10-09
Tho
m
a
s
Preud'hom
m
e
Supp
o
rt for R_ARM_[THM
_
]MOV{W,T}_
A
BS
[
_NC} relocs
commit
|
commitdiff
|
tree
2012-07-30
T
h
omas
P
reud'homme
Dis
a
ble callsave_
t
e
s
t for arm
commit
|
commitdiff
|
tree
2012-07-29
T
h
omas Preud'homme
Add multiar
c
h directory for arm ha
r
dfloat variant
commit
|
commitdiff
|
tree
2012-07-11
Thomas
P
r
e
ud'homme
g
e
t_reg(): try t
o
free r2 for an SValue fir
s
t
commit
|
commitdiff
|
tree
2012-07-09
Thom
a
s
Preud'homm
e
Fi
x
R_ARM_REL32 reloc
a
tion
commit
|
commitdiff
|
tree
2012-06-13
T
homa
s
Preud
'
homme
Detect multiarch on Kfreeb
s
d and Hurd
commit
|
commitdiff
|
tree
2012-06-12
Thomas
Preud'h
o
mme
Evaluate configure argume
n
ts
commit
|
commitdiff
|
tree
2012-06-05
Th
o
m
a
s P
r
e
ud'homme
t
c
c
e
lf
.
c
:
Add R_ARM_REL32 re
l
oc
a
t
ion
commit
|
commitdiff
|
tree
2012-06-05
Thomas
P
reud'homme
Ad
d
support for ar
m
hard
f
lo
a
t c
a
lling convention
commit
|
commitdiff
|
tree
2012-06-05
Thomas Preud
'
homme
Fix removal of vn
r
ott
commit
|
commitdiff
|
tree
2012-05-28
Thomas
Preu
d
'hom
m
e
Only warn for unknown options in conf
i
gure script
commit
|
commitdiff
|
tree
2012-05-22
Thomas Preud
'
homme
Sev
e
ra
l
multiarch/b
i
arch fixes
commit
|
commitdiff
|
tree
2012-05-22
Th
o
ma
s
Preud'homme
Fix CON
F
I
G_LDDIR u
s
age
commit
|
commitdiff
|
tree
2012-04-10
Thomas Preud'ho
m
m
e
Revert
"
Use CString to c
o
ncat lin
k
er options"
commit
|
commitdiff
|
tree
2012-03-20
Thomas
P
r
e
ud'homme
Use CS
t
ring to concat linke
r
options
commit
|
commitdiff
|
tree
2012-03-16
T
homas Pr
e
u
d'hom
m
e
Fix use after fre
e
for linker_
a
rg
commit
|
commitdiff
|
tree
2012-03-14
Thomas Preud'homme
Support linker o
p
tions passed i
n
seve
r
al -Wl para
m
commit
|
commitdiff
|
tree
2012-03-14
Th
o
mas Preud'homme
Con
s
ider long int const
a
nt as 64 bits on x
8
6-6
4
commit
|
commitdiff
|
tree
2012-03-14
Thoma
s
P
r
eud'homme
R
e
m
ove v
n
rott (du
p
licate vrotb)
commit
|
commitdiff
|
tree
2012-03-13
Thomas Pr
e
u
d
'h
o
mme
I
n
fo
r
m
user t
h
a
t
-b only exists on
i
386
.
commit
|
commitdiff
|
tree
2012-01-22
T
h
om
a
s
Preu
d
'homme
Error out when assignin
g
void
value
.
commit
|
commitdiff
|
tree
2012-01-08
Thomas Pre
u
d'homme
s/de
r
e
fencing/dereferencing/ i
n
i
3
86-ge
n
.
c
commit
|
commitdiff
|
tree
2012-01-06
Thomas Preud'homme
C
ompile tc
c
asm
.
c conditionally (
T
CC_CONF
I
G_ASM
)
commit
|
commitdiff
|
tree
2012-01-04
Thomas Preu
d
'ho
m
me
Fix
linkage of named file in lo
a
d
e
r script
.
commit
|
commitdiff
|
tree
2011-08-12
Thomas Preud'homme
Don't defi
n
e
strtold and
s
trtof on
*
BSD
+
u
C
libc
commit
|
commitdiff
|
tree